This skill makes an AI agent author Artillery 2.x load tests as declarative YAML: realistic traffic phases, multi-step scenarios with captured variables, CSV-driven virtual user data, functional expect checks inside load flows, and ensure thresholds that turn latency regressions into red CI builds. Trigger it when a project contains artillery.yml, artillery in package.json, or when the user asks for load, stress, soak, or spike testing of an HTTP API or website in a Node.js stack.

afterResponse: logSlowResponse// processor.js
module.exports = { generateOrderPayload, logSlowResponse };
function generateOrderPayload(context, events, done) {
// Runs before the request; sets template variables on the VU context
context.vars.sku = `SKU-${1000 + Math.floor(Math.random() * 9000)}`;
context.vars.quantity = 1 + Math.floor(Math.random() * 4);
return done();
}
function logSlowResponse(requestParams, response, context, events, done) {
const tookMs = response.timings ? response.timings.phases.total : 0;
if (tookMs > 1000) {
console.warn(`SLOW ${requestParams.url} -> ${response.statusCode} in ${tookMs}ms`);
events.emit('counter', 'custom.slow_responses', 1);
}
return done();
}The ensure plugin makes Artillery exit with code 1 on any threshold breach, so the job fails without extra scripting.
